Q&A with Lewis Hamilton

Fri, 11 July 2008, 09:22

Following the first day of testing at Hockenheim in Germany, Vodafone McLaren Mercedes F1 Team driver Lewis Hamilton spoke with a group of reporters at the circuit. The Hockenheim test kicked off only 48 hours after Lewis won his home Grand Prix at Silverstone.

After your victory at the Santander British Grand Prix how does it feel to be back testing?
“I am pleased to be back testing as I just love spending time in the car. It’s a great feeling being part of the development process with the team and I do anything I can to help. We are all pushing hard to try and win the World Championships.”

Have you taken a step forward with the car since Silverstone?
“Its too early say where we are but we have taken some steps forward but as always we will have to wait and see.”

Do you like the Hockenheim circuit?
“I like this track and today is obviously the first day I have had the opportunity to drive a Formula 1 car here. I have enjoyed some success here in Formula 3 and it’s been really enjoyable driving the Formula 1 car today – I would have loved to drive the old circuit though as well.”

Have you had the opportunity to watch the Santander British Grand Prix yet and how did you celebrate your victory in your home grand prix last Sunday?
“I caught some of the highlights on Sunday night but I haven’t watched the whole race – I was actually in bed by 11.00 after a family dinner and had the best nights sleep ever!”

What do you think about the Championship battle?
“The championship is exciting as a number of us are on equal points so it should be an interesting second half of the season where Heikki and I want to continue to score points and win races.”

Who do you think will win the World Championship?
“My guess is that the Championship will be decided at the last race – just like last year – but we will see.”

Do you look forward to competing at Mercedes-Benz’ home grand prix?
“Obviously I have just won my home grand prix at Silverstone which was fantastic. However, the Hockenheim race is important for the team due to Mercedes-Benz and of course I want to do well here. The support we get in Germany is amazing and it would be great to have a one-two.”

Finally, today there has been a story on some websites that you are possibly looking at working with a different management team – is that correct?
“Thank you for asking and I can say that this is definitely not true. I am very happy with my management team.”
